iOS app签名有效期和需要注意的事项

苹果签名是指通过对iOS应用进行数字签名来证明其身份和完整性的过程。所有的iOS应用都必须经过签名才能在设备上运行。签名有效期是指签名证书的有效期,也是应用程序在用户设备上可运行的期限。

签名证书的有效期

iOS签名证书的有效期通常为一年。在签名证书即将到期时,您需要更新证书来确保应用程序继续运行。

实际上,如果应用程序使用了某些苹果提供的服务(如推送通知、iCloud等),则在签名证书过期前,您应该及时更新证书,以确保应用程序能够继续使用这些服务。

如果您没有及时更新签名证书,则应用程序将无法在用户设备上继续运行。如果用户尝试打开已经过期的应用程序,会收到一个错误消息,并提示用户要联系开发者更新该应用程序。

需要注意的事项

在签名iOS应用程序时,有几个需要注意的事项:

1. 使用不可逆算法

当您签名一个iOS应用程序时,您应该使用不可逆算法来确保签名过程是完整、安全和不可篡改的。

iOS app签名有效期和需要注意的事项

2. 私有密钥的保护

签名iOS应用程序时,私有密钥是非常重要的。如果您的私有密钥泄露,那么攻击者就可以篡改您的应用程序,甚至发布恶意代码。

因此,您应该非常小心地保护您的私有密钥。您可以将它存储在受保护的计算机或专门的数字安全硬件中,以确保其安全。

3. 使用开发者证书

在签名iOS应用程序时,您可以使用“开发者证书”或“发布证书”。开发者证书是用于签名开发期测试版应用程序,而发布证书是用于签名正式发布版应用程序。

4. 确保签名证书的私钥匹配

签名iOS应用程序时,您应该确保签名证书的私钥与应用程序的证书匹配。否则,您将无法使用签名证书对应用程序进行签名。

5. 选择有信誉的签名服务提供商

签名iOS应用程序的过程需要确保所有的数据都受到保护,并且只有授权人可以访问和签名数据。因此,您应该选择有信誉的签名服务提供商来确保您的数据安全。

总之,iOS签名证书的有效期是很关键的。如果您的签名证书过期了,您需要尽快更新签名证书,以确保您的应用程序能够继续运行。

相关新闻

联系我们

联系我们

QQ:2869296718

在线咨询:点击这里给我发消息

联系微信
联系微信
分享本页
返回顶部